Nuclear hormone receptors form a complex with their ligands, other proteins, and DNA control elements in order to regulate the expression of specific genes. These nuclear hormone receptors have four principal domains. Categorize each trait according to the appropriate nuclear hormone receptor domain with which it is associated.

Answers

Answer:

Explanation:

Nuclear receptors are a type of protein that functions as an intracellular steroid and thyroid hormone receptor. The interaction of these hormones in conjunction with nuclear receptors changes the pattern of gene expression, allowing certain genes to be transcribed while others are silenced.

As a consequence, unique mRNA translation products, proteins, and, in most cases, enzymes are generated. Nuclear receptors connect to DNA directly and control the expression of certain genes, regulating the organisms growth, homeostasis, and metabolism.

The following domains are found in a normal nuclear receptor:

The amino-terminal activation domain contains the transcriptional activation mechanism and is strongly variable in sequence (AF1). The recruiting of coregulators is the domains key feature.

⇒ Activation function 1 (AF1); Coregulator recruitment

DNA binding domain: It is amongst the most closely conserved centrally located domains, with two zinc fingers that attach to specific DNA sequences known as hormone reaction components (HRE).

⇒ nine conserved cysteine residues; zinc finger domain; center of the receptor.

The hiinge domain serves as a versatile connection between the DNA binding and ligand-binding domains. It has a nuclear localization signal in it. ⇒ Nuclear localization signal

Ligand binding domain:  The sequence of the ligand-binding domain is moderately conserved throughout nuclear receptors. It denotes the carboxyl-terminal end of a ligand domain. It has hydrophobic steroid-binding pockets that draw the hormone and AF2 activation domains. It also attaches to proteins that serve as coactivators and corepressors.

⇒ binding of corepressor proteins;  steroid-binding hydrophobic pocket; AF2 activation domain; binds coactivators; carboxyl-terminal end

What are the REACTANTS in photosynthesis?

[A] Carbon dioxide (CO2), water (H2O), and ATP

[B] Carbon dioxide (CO2), water (H2O), and sunlight

[C] Glucose (C6H12O6) and oxygen (O2)

Answers

Answer:

[tex]\boxed {\boxed {\sf B. \ Carbon \ dioxide , water, and \ sunlight}}[/tex]

Explanation:

The reactants are the substances that go into a reaction. You begin with the reactants, then the reaction turns them into different products.

Remember, photosynthesis is a process that certain organisms, like plants, algae, and some types of bacteria, undergo to create "food". They actually produce glucose which serves as an energy source because it is converted into ATP during cellular respiration.

The formula for photosynthesis is:

[tex]6H_2O+6CO_2+ light \ energy \rightarrow C_6H_12O_6 + 6O_2[/tex]

or

[tex]water + carbon \ dioxide + light \ energy \rightarrow glucose + oxygen[/tex]

The reactants are the starting substances, so they are to the left of the arrow. Therefore, the reactants are carbon dioxide (CO₂) water (H₂O), and sunlight. Choice B is correct.

Explain why serine proteases do not catalyze hydrolysis if the amino acid at the hydrolysis site is a D-amino acid. Trypsin, for example, cleaves on the CC-side of L-ArgArg and L-LysLys, but not on the CC-side of D-ArgArg and D-LysLys.

Answers

Answer:

Explanation:

A protease is an enzyme that catalyzes the hydrolysis of the peptide bonds that tie polypeptide chains together, releasing individual amino acid subunits. The L and D nomenclature for amino acids defines the structure of the glyceraldehyde isomer through which the amino acid can be produced.

SEE BELOW FOR THE APPROPRIATE STRUCTURES.

We need to figure out why swine proteases hydrolyze L-amino acids but not D-amino acids in any way. we know that enzymatic catalysts act as polypeptides if you can recall. They must retain a very precise three-dimensional structure for a catalytic activity to occur. Substrates that do not quite match the required configuration at the active site will not be reacted to — this is a "lock and key" style.

The present exercise may be explained by the fact that the configuration and structure of D-amino acids prevent them from binding properly to the active site of the protease enzyme. Perhaps they're pointed in the wrong direction, or perhaps there happens to be missing electrical interaction that's needed to keep the substrate in position.

Nonetheless, L-amino acids, on the other hand, seem to have the right configurational aspects in the active site and are hydrolyzed.

Which statement is correct?
Meiosis and mitosis produces plant and bacteria cells
Mitosis produces plant cells and meiosis produces bacteria cells
Meiosis produces body cells and mitosis produces body cells
Mitosis produces body cells and meiosis produces sex cells

Answers

the last one
Mitosis is the process by which a cell divides once to create two daughter cells. These daughter cells are somatic (body) cells.

Meiosis is the process by which a cell divides twice to create four daughter cells. These daughter cells are sex cells (gametes).

2. A fruit fly is classified as a consumer rather than as a producer because it is unable to 1. reproduce asexually 2. synthesize its own food 3. release energy stored in organic molecules 4. remove wastes from its body​

Answers

Answer:

2. synthesize its own food

Explanation:

Based on how they obtain their nutrition, living organisms has been classified to be either producers, consumers, or decomposers. Producers are organisms capable of synthesizing their own food using light (photosynthesis) or inorganic chemicals (chemosynthesis).

Consumers, on the other hand, cannot synthesize their own food and hence, rely on other organisms to obtain their energy source. Consumers feed on other organisms to obtain energy. In this question, a fruit fly is classified as a CONSUMER because it cannot synthesize its own food.

The formation of urea from ammonia takes place in the..........​

Answers

Answer:

Liver

Explanation:

Organisms that cannot easily and safely remove nitrogen as ammonia convert it to a less toxic substance, such as urea, via the urea cycle, which occurs mainly in the liver. Urea produced by the liver is then released into the bloodstream, where it travels to the kidneys and is ultimately excreted in urine.
